The film is a neo-surrealist piece. It tells a fortuitous encounter of a young man before his marriage proposal. The protagonist prepares for his proposal in a public restroom of a hotel. After making sure no one is using the restroom, he locks the door and starts to rehearse. A flushing sound suddenly interrupts his rehearsal, and a middle-aged man walks out of one of the toilet cubicles. Then he tries to open a weird small talk about the wedding ring, which makes protagonist suspicious of his motives. I did not give any hint or explanation about who the middle-aged man may be, how he possibly got in there, and what his purpose exactly is. I left the film with an ambiguous open ending on purpose to arouse curiosity and motivate the audience to think about the answers. In fact, it is impossible for the middle-aged man to suddenly appear out of thin air, since the young man has checked the entire room, and made sure there was no on in there. Thus, he should be an imaginary character created by protagonist’s subconscious mind and means to test his own determination. Similarly the edge between reality and subconscious world is patently blurry in the film, or there is even no boundaries between them. The reason why the confusions have arisen is because of a persistent cognition constructed by the everyday experience, and the thoughts and senses perceived from the material world. People artificially split their awareness into different segments such as subject vs. object, inside vs. outside, or instinct vs. reasonable. By that means, they automatically draw a mental line across the conscious and subconscious mind in order to survive in the real world. People normally refuse and even are afraid of applying intuition and subconscious mind in daily life. Otherwise, they would be considered as a psychopath or a pipe dreamer. On the contrary, I have been trying to release their potential – the divine powers – in the cinematic world that I call it “neo-surrealist cinema”.
